Description


The Xilinx License Configuration Manager (XLCM) is supposed to list all of the licenses that are available for Xilinx software tools. However, I have IP licenses from previous releases that do not show up in XLCM.  

 

Will the CORE Generator software and ISE design tools find IP core licenses in my %HOMEDRIVE%\coregen\CoreLicenses (e.g., C:\.xilinx\coregen\CoreLicenses) directory?

Solution


The 11.1 CORE Generator software and Xlicmgr (used for Xilinx license checking) still find the licenses correctly in the %HOMEDRIVE%\coregen\CoreLicenses directory. 

 

You can successfully generate a core, as well as implement and program a device with a design, using a core whose license resides in the %HOMEDRIVE%\coregen\CoreLicenses directory. 

 

To check the status of the IP core license, use "xlicmgr status -c <feature name>". 

 

This is resolved in the 11.2 ISE software release.
